Angier, NC experiences a humid subtropical climate with hot, humid summers and mild winters, placing a high demand on reliable and efficient air conditioning systems for a significant portion of the year. The winter season requires dependable heating, primarily from heat pumps and gas furnaces. The local HVAC market is competitive with a mix of long-standing local companies and larger regional providers serving the area. Homeowners prioritize energy efficiency due to seasonal runtimes and look for contractors with strong emergency service capabilities, especially during summer heatwaves.

For a full system replacement in Angier, homeowners can expect a typical range of $5,000 to $12,000, depending on system size, efficiency rating, and home complexity. Local factors include our humid subtropical climate, which often necessitates systems with strong dehumidification capabilities, and the prevalence of older homes that may require ductwork modifications. Choosing a higher SEER (Seasonal Energy Efficiency Ratio) unit, while a larger upfront investment, is highly recommended for long-term savings given our hot, humid summers.
The optimal time for proactive maintenance is during the spring (March-April) and fall (September-October), avoiding the peak demand of summer and winter. For system replacements, scheduling during these shoulder seasons is ideal as HVAC companies in the Triangle area have more availability and you can avoid emergency premiums. This timing ensures your system is fully serviced before the intense summer heat and humidity, which typically arrive by late May, set in.
Yes, most HVAC installations and replacements in Angier require a permit from the Town of Angier's Planning & Inspections Department. A licensed HVAC contractor will typically pull this permit, which ensures the work meets North Carolina's current mechanical and energy conservation codes. This is crucial for safety, system performance, and can be required for home insurance and future resale. Always verify your contractor is properly licensed to work in Harnett County.
Prioritize contractors who are locally established, licensed by the North Carolina State Board of Examiners of Plumbing, Heating, and Fire Sprinkler Contractors, and insured. Look for companies with strong experience in Angier's specific housing stock, from newer subdivisions to older homes. Check for verified reviews on local platforms and ask for references. A trustworthy contractor will perform a detailed load calculation (Manual J) for your home, not just size the new system based on the old one.
It is normal for your system to run in longer cycles during extreme heat, especially when temperatures exceed 95°F, which is common here. However, if it runs non-stop without adequately cooling your home (e.g., not maintaining a 15-20 degree difference from outside), it indicates a problem. Common local issues include refrigerant leaks, a dirty condenser coil hindered by our high pollen count, or an undersized system. Scheduling a diagnostic service is recommended to prevent a complete breakdown during peak season.
